This comprehensive guide expertly distills the vast landscape of large-diameter shield tunneling technology. Authored by a team of eminent shield technology experts with hands-on experience, it presents a treasure trove of real-world engineering data and examples, and simplifies complex concepts for easy comprehension.Its ten chapters offer a structured journey, commencing with Chapter 1, which chronicles the global evolution and innovations in large-diameter tunnel construction technology. Chapter 2 unveils cutting-edge designs and vital functions of contemporary large-diameter shield machines. Chapter 3 explores integrated slurry treatment systems, emphasizing zero-discharge processes, while Chapter 4 delves into high-precision steel mold design and advanced segment production techniques.Chapters 5 and 6 provide in-depth insights into excavation processes, encompassing starting and receiving procedures, excavation face stability, shield body posture management, segment assembly, and synchronous grouting. Chapter 7 adopts an informatics perspective, elucidating data management and control. The critical topic of risk management and countermeasures takes center stage in Chapter 8, while Chapter 9 spotlights domestic large-diameter shield tunneling projects and their pivotal technologies. Lastly, in Chapter 10, the book offers a forward-looking vision for the future of tunneling and shield machine development.Tailored for professionals in design and construction, researchers in scientific institutes, and those engaged in tunnel and underground engineering, this book serves as an invaluable resource. Based on the construction of Nanjing Weisan Road Yangtze River Tunnel, this book comprehensively introduces the new technology of large-diameter shield tunnel construction crossing circular air shafts. It focuses on four aspects: the construction technology of super-deep circular air shaft foundation pit retaining structure in the sensitive environment near the river, underwater excavation and underwater massive concrete sealing bottom construction technology, adaptive improvement of TBM and construction technology of crossing air shaft, and control technology of super-deep foundation pit stability during the process of conversion. Shield Construction Techniques in Tunnelling presents the latest on this fast, environmentally-friendly and relatively safe construction technique, reflecting on its technical risks and challenges as seen in China. Sections introduce the type of shields, the history of the technique, shielding principles, selection, management, the latest techniques in operation, consider engineering cases, discuss construction in gravel, soft-soil, composite, and rock strata, and present video clips of construction that are accessible through QR codes embedded in the text. The book combines theory and practical experience, giving the reader unique insights into shield equipment and construction techniques. The shield tunneling technique is being used very widely, particularly in China, which is building urban-rail transit systems at an unparalleled scale and speed. The use of tunneling-shields provides a fast, relatively-safe, and ecologically-friendly method for the construction of tunnels. This book introduces shield construction risks under mixed face ground condition, analyzes the shield tunneling risks, gives definitions of relevant risks and creates the theoretical system of shield tunneling technology under mixed face ground condition, that is, geology is the foundation, TBM is the key, and people (management) is the essence. The content provides numbers of targeted solutions, such as dual-mode TBM, multi-mode TBM, millisecond delay blasting for boulders, Paste HDN, auxiliary pressure balance tunneling and so on. Mechanised shield tunnelling has developed considerably since the publication of the first edition of this book. Challenging tunnel projects under difficult conditions demand innovative solutions, which has led to constant further development and innovation in process technology, constructions operations and the machines and materials used. The book collects the latest state of technology in mechanised shield tunnelling. It describes the basics of mechanised tunnelling technology and the various types of machines and gives calculation methods and constructural advice. Further chapters cover excavation tools, muck handling, tunnel support, surveying and steering as well as workplace safety. There is also detailled information about contractual aspects and process controlling.

This book focuses on some technical problems encountered in shield tunneling in hard–soft uneven stratum and extremely soft stratum, based on the recent shield tunneling engineering practice, and summarizes the achievements of shield tunneling in view of the technical problems from an overall and objective perspective. There are 6 chapters in this book. Chapter 1 introduces the development trend of shield tunneling method, defines classification of various stratum where shield tunneling applies, and mainly analyses the selection of shield machines and the configuration of cutters. Chapters 2 to 5 elaborates the strata characteristics and construction difficulties under various stratum conditions, puts forward adaptive selection and design keys of shield in various stratum, and emphatically analyses and summarizes the stability control technologies of shield tunnel face and driving control technology by case studies. Chapter 6 introduces the shield chamber opening technologies under hyperbaric condition, emphatically presents the basic requirements and operational preparations for the shield chamber opening, and puts forward innovative ideas of operation procedures, control points of key procedures, and safety requirements of shield chamber opening under hyperbaric condition.

Shield Tunnel Engineering: From Theory to Practice is a key technique that offers one of the most important ways to build tunnels in fast, relatively safe, and ecologically friendly ways. The book presents state-of-the-art solutions for engineers working within the field of shield tunnelling technology for railways. It includes expertise from major projects in shield tunnel construction for high-speed rail, subways and other major projects. In particular, it presents a series of advances in shield muck conditioning technology, slurry treatment, backfill grouting, and environmental impact and control. In this volume, foundational knowledge is combined with the latest advances in shield tunnel engineering. Twelve chapters cover key areas including geological investigation, the types, structures and workings of shield machines, selecting a machine, shield segment design, shield tunnelling parameter control, soil conditioning for earth pressure balance (EPB) shield tunnelling, shield slurry treatment, backfill grouting, environmental impact, and problems in shield tunnel structures and their amelioration.
